Log compaction behaves differently in each, which matters during incidents. In dev, compaction is aggressive and may discard messages mid-investigation; in prod, segments are retained much longer and compaction only runs off-peak. If consumers report missing keys, check whether a compaction cycle completed recently before assuming data loss. Staging mirrors prod retention but compacts twice as often, so repro attempts there can mislead. The production compaction settings currently in effect are listed below.

settings of fafog-haduf:
ZORIX_PIN=4648
ZORIX_METRICS_HOST=metrics.zorix.paliqsys.corp
ZORIX_LOG_LEVEL=info
ZORIX_TENANT=druix

# Break-Glass: Catalog Cache Invalidation

Scope: the Pinrow product catalog at Veldstone Retail. If stale prices persist after a purge and the Hollowmere invalidation queue is wedged, use break-glass to flush the edge tier directly. Contractors: get verbal sign-off from the catalog lead first. Steps: open the Hollowmere admin shell, select emergency-flush, confirm the tenant, and run it once — repeated flushes thrash the origin. Access is logged and expires after 20 minutes. Unseal the admin shell with the passphrase below.

recovery phrase for kahop-tajog: istix-casvan

The Mercadine product catalog caches listing pages in the Frostbin layer for twelve hours. When merchandisers publish price or availability changes through Stockwright, an invalidation event should propagate within sixty seconds; if customers report stale listings beyond that window, the event relay has likely stalled. As a contractor, do not flush the entire cache — target only the affected product namespaces using the invalidation endpoint. That endpoint requires the internal relay credential, which you will find directly below.

service key, fajog-fahag: kto11_2MzOs43qWZq